Default Looking for good Ipad mount

I run Navionics on my Ipad and Iphone for GPS. Normally just have the phone on a suction windshield mount, but would like to find a good mount for the Ipad (bigger screen, faster processing, etc.).

Maybe a window mount, maybe something else.... waterproof would be good too.

Any ideas? Thanks!

This is my new setup with a 3G iPad 2 on my Stingray 230sx. It is a RAM Rail Mount kit and I bought it on eBay. The rail mount kit is VERY adjustable/sturdy(I would not use a suction mount for an iPad) and attaches perfectly to my windsheild rail. I am going to hardwire it in to my CD Deck(which has a USB power source) and it will be able to control all the music from it as well. I will be testing it out this summer.

The main problem with all waterproof iPad cases is that you can't have the power cord or the headphone jack hooked up.

I am hoping mine will be semi-safe up under the windshield. The main thing that I am worried about is over heating. I know that I have had my iPhone out on the boat and gotten the over heat warning a few times. I guess if it gets a little hot, I will just throw a towel over it. And if it is about to get wet from rain or rough water, I will throw a gallon size zip-loc bag over it. -Or- I can easily unclip it and throw it in the cabin... I am definitely looking forward to testing it out though
